Product Description
A health care manual for people traveling with pets in areas where limited veterinary facilities are available such as those on boats or RV's or those in wilderness or third world environments. Addresses ways that you, as a pet owner with common sense and a few skills, may be able to treat temporarily until professional care is available and includes info on how to best prepare your pet for obtaining an import permit into the greatest number of countries. Includes a rating system to rate various procedures according to degree of difficulty and possible risk to the patient. Included are suggested lists of drugs and supplies, again rated according to user skill level and duration of trip. A drug formulary is provided which gives proper drug dosages for many medications, even if limited only to your human medical kit. This book is applicable to backwoods travelers, international travelers, and those spending substantial time in areas where veterinary services are unavailable.

3 out of 5 stars needs a few additions/revisions   November 13, 2009
K. Blankenship (Niceville, FL)
My wife and I are going to be living in South America for the next few years, so we got this book. I just got the book today, however, I was expecting something along the lines of "where there is no doctor". I mean, if you are going to name your book after an awesome book, you should copy all of the awesomeness from it.

Where there is no Pet Doctor lacks all of the helpful diagrams, charts, and easy navigability.

This could be a great book if they took the time to add in those things. I'm not saying the material in the book isn't good. But if it's hard to take in the information and hard to find the information. That would make a huge difference. Hope this review helps.
